Dengue preparedness meet held at Joda

A meeting was held in the Joda Municipality office to discuss about taking some preventive measures so that there will be no dengue cases this year.

It is to be noted that three years back, dengue had created an alarming situation in the Joda-Barbil region by affecting more than thousands of people and also had taken a heavy toll of lives.

However, more than half of the councillors who have been elected by the citizens to look after the wellbeing of the municipality were absent.

Similarly, mines owners and business houses like PMP, Indrani Patnaik ,Mala Roy, DR Patnaik, KMC ,KC Pradhan and  many others are earning cores of rupees from this mining land of Joda but are remaining absent in the meeting to  discuss about their participation for the welfare of Joda.

However, Thriveni and Essel Mining had sent the message that they will agree to the decision taken in the meeting.

EO Suryamani Patajoshi thanked all for no outbreak of dengue till now and hoped that the same will continue in future for which he sought the cooperation of all.

Others who were present in the meeting were seven councillors, including Chairperson of civic body, Subash Chandra Mohanty of Sirajuddin,Tammany Kar of Tata Steel and Umakanta Mahato of Rungta.
